This is a single centre dose-finding and proof-of-concept study in healthy volunteers to assess the effects of single doses of NRL001 on the mean anal resting pressure (MARP). In addition, the pharmacokinetics of NRL001 and subject safety are also examined.
The study consists of four parts, which evaluate different NRL001 concentrations and sites of application. Treatments consist of a single local application of either 0.3%, 1% or 3% w/w NRL001 gel applied peri-anally, of either 1% or 3% w/w NRL001 gel applied intra-anally, or 1% w/w NRL001 administered rectally. In addition, a 10 mg NRL001-containing suppository applied to the rectum is assessed.
